Tonight after I left bike night at quaker steak and lube and were going down col. glen. There was a "team mullet" drag bike in front of all of us. I think it was a suzuki gs1000. great looking bike. anywho, I was riding along at the very back of the pack doing like 35. and passed a fairborn police officer. and some guy on another bike takes off and does god knows how fast. im still just cruising along. next thing i know im getting pulled over! He tells me hes pulling me over for having the visor up on my helmet, and not having saftey glasses. I suppose its legit, thats the law. I wear regular eye glasses, but thats not good enough. He takes my licences and comes back and tells me I need to get home its almost dark. I ask him what that has to do with anything and he told me that my licences says novice. that means i cant ride on the highway, after dark, with a passenger, and whatever else the laws are for a permit. He continued to tell me that i just had my permit and did not have my motorcycle endorsement. I showed it to him on my licences, and even showed him my card of completion of the MSF course(grantid its just a peice of paper and doesnt mean much) but it got me my endorcement.Needless to say i just got a warning, and told to get home because it was almost dark, Is this kind of stuff common practice out of fairborn officers to not know what the rules are on such subjects?? If so I dont think I will frequent bike night as much as planned.
The face shield reason the cop gave you is BS. Eyeglasses qualify as "Other" protective devices, see below. Yea you have to scroll a bit but I bolded it so it's easer to find. Feel free to print this out and keep it under the seat.
4511.53 Operation of bicycles, motorcycles and snowmobiles.
(A) For purposes of this section, “snowmobile” has the same meaning as given that term in section 4519.01 of the Revised Code.
(B) No person operating a bicycle shall ride other than upon or astride the permanent and regular seat attached thereto or carry any other person upon such bicycle other than upon a firmly attached and regular seat thereon, and no person shall ride upon a bicycle other than upon such a firmly attached and regular seat.
No person operating a motorcycle shall ride other than upon or astride the permanent and regular seat or saddle attached thereto, or carry any other person upon such motorcycle other than upon a firmly attached and regular seat or saddle thereon, and no person shall ride upon a motorcycle other than upon such a firmly attached and regular seat or saddle.
No person shall ride upon a motorcycle that is equipped with a saddle other than while sitting astride the saddle, facing forward, with one leg on each side of the motorcycle.
No person shall ride upon a motorcycle that is equipped with a seat other than while sitting upon the seat.
No person operating a bicycle shall carry any package, bundle, or article that prevents the driver from keeping at least one hand upon the handle bars.
No bicycle or motorcycle shall be used to carry more persons at one time than the number for which it is designed and equipped, nor shall any motorcycle be operated on a highway when the handle bars or grips are more than fifteen inches higher than the seat or saddle for the operator.
No person shall operate or be a passenger on a snowmobile or motorcycle without using safety glasses or other protective eye device(1). No person who is under the age of eighteen years, or who holds a motorcycle operator’s endorsement or license bearing a “novice” designation that is currently in effect as provided in section 4507.13 of the Revised Code, shall operate a motorcycle on a highway, or be a passenger on a motorcycle, unless wearing a protective helmet on the person’s head, and no other person shall be a passenger on a motorcycle operated by such a person unless similarly wearing a protective helmet. The helmet, safety glasses, or other protective eye device shall conform with regulations prescribed and promulgated by the director of public safety(2). The provisions of this paragraph or a violation thereof shall not be used in the trial of any civil action.
© Nothing in this section shall be construed as prohibiting the carrying of a child in a seat or trailer that is designed for carrying children and is firmly attached to the bicycle.
(D) Except as otherwise provided in this division, whoever violates this section is guilty of a minor misdemeanor. If, within one year of the offense, the offender previously has been convicted of or pleaded guilty to one predicate motor vehicle or traffic offense, whoever violates this section is guilty of a misdemeanor of the fourth degree. If, within one year of the offense, the offender previously has been convicted of two or more predicate motor vehicle or traffic offenses, whoever violates this section is guilty of a misdemeanor of the third degree.
Effective Date: 01-01-2004; 09-21-2006; 2008 HB562 09-22-2008
So politely tell the police that you think the law states otherwise and you will see them in court over it.
Keep in mind Mayors court isn't really a court it is a "Hearsay" court.
It is not a "Court Of Record" so you can appeal any ruling of that [sic] court.
Quote the statute and I'll bet they back down.
(1) Other protective device is not defined. It is simply "OTHER"!!! It is not defined as a face shield nor can it be construed as such.
(2) If it has not been banned by the director it can be assumed to be approved is one way of looking at it.
Getting the Dept of public safety to rule on it will prolly never happen.
Citation: http://codes.ohio.gov/orc/4511
Disclamer: I am not a lawyer, but I can cut and paste from the official Ohio site. Proceed at your own risk!
